Don't cook up danger in the kitchen
Kitchens are comfortable places where families and friends can hang out, but they can be dangerous for small children. Here are a few basic safety precautions to implement so everyone stays safe:
- Keep knives, scissors, and other sharp instruments locked or in a location too high for kids to reach.
- When cooking, keep pots and pans on the rear burners as much as possible, or turn their handles so young hands can’t grab them.
- Unplug appliances when you’re not using them. Make sure their cords are out of reach. (Telephone cords, too.)
